22.Matlab语法

2023-12-03  本文已影响0人  豚大叔的小屋

1.addpath
若matlab需要将某文件夹及其全部子文件夹路径添加为搜索路径
设当前路径为D:/Material, 需要将该路径下面的folder以及folder下的全部子文件夹添加进搜索路径。
1)添加绝对路径:
addpath(genpath(‘F:/Material/folder’))
2)添加相对路径:
addpath(genpath(‘folder’))
2.circshift是循环移位函数。可以使用于数组和矩阵元素的循环移位。
当A是数组
B=circshift(A,p);如果p是正数则实现A从左到右的循环移位。如果p是负数则实现A从右到左的循环移位。
当A是矩阵
B=circshift(A,[p,0]);如果p是正数则实现A以行为单位,从上到下的循环移位。如果p是负数则实现从下到上的循环移位。
B=circshift(A,[0,p]);如果p是正数则实现A以列为单位,从左到右的循环移位。如果p是负数则实现从右到左的循环移位。
3.Y = fft2([X]使用快速傅里叶变换算法返回矩阵的[二维傅里叶变换

上一篇下一篇

猜你喜欢

热点阅读